The Psychology Behind Addictive Games
Before exploring the specifics of the Chicken Game, it’s essential to understand the psychological factors that contribute to casino its addictive nature. Casino games often rely on exploiting the brain’s reward system, using mechanisms such as:
- Variable rewards: the unpredictability of outcomes creates anticipation and expectation
- Immediate gratification: instant payouts or wins stimulate dopamine release
- Escalation: gradually increasing stakes or difficulties encourage players to continue

The Impact of Addictive Games on Players
While it’s undeniable that Roobet’s Chicken Game can be highly engaging, its addictive nature also raises concerns about player well-being. Regular exposure to high-stakes betting and unpredictable outcomes may lead to:
- Financial difficulties : spending beyond one’s means or chasing losses
- Emotional strain : stress and anxiety resulting from financial pressures
Casinos often incorporate features aimed at promoting responsible gaming, such as deposit limits and reality checks. However, more must be done to address the underlying issues driving player addiction.
